WORKFORCE DEVELOPMENT

 

Our region’s manufacturing companies face severe shortages of skilled workers. This shortage will worsen as the Baby Boom generation retires. The training pipeline leading to manufacturing companies is largely empty. Many of those who do make their way to our front door often lack the hard and soft skills needed to succeed.

 

MFG 21’s role is not to deliver programs or replace existing systems. We are committed to rolling up our sleeves, as a private industry-led group, and working with workforce development boards, community colleges, universities and private organizations to ensure we have a skilled and work-ready workforce. We are confident that if we do this, we will create opportunities for the people of the region and success for our companies in the years to come.
